Before attempting any repairs, examine the problem at hand. Common door hardware issues consist of:
Squeaky hingesMisaligned doorsLocks that will not engageLoose deals with or knobs2. Gather Your Tools
To efficiently repair door hardware, you'll require some common tools:
ToolFunctionScrewdriverTo remove screws from hinges, locks, and handles.LubeTo lower friction (e.g., WD-40).Replacement PartsFor fixing broken components.LevelTo ensure the door is correctly aligned.Drill (optional)For setting up brand-new hardware.3. Repairing Common IssuesA. Squeaky Hinges
Solution: Apply lubricant to the hinges.
Remove the hinge pin if needed.Tidy off old grease with a cloth.Apply lubricant and reinsert the pin.B. Misaligned Doors
Option: Adjust the hinges.
Utilize a level to inspect positioning.If the door is too high/low, change hinge screws appropriately.C. Stubborn Locks
Option: Clean and lube the lock or change it.
Utilize a dry lube to avoid dust from collecting.If the lock is beyond repair, consider changing it.D. Loose Handles or Knobs
Option: Tighten or change screws.
Check the screws holding the handle or knob.If removed, use a larger screw or insert a toothpick into the hole before reinserting the screw.4. Replacing Hardware

Avoid future issues by following these maintenance pointers:
Lubricate Moving Parts: Regularly apply lubricant to hinges and locks.Examine Alignment: Periodically examine that the door is aligned appropriately.Tighten Loose Screws: Inspect and tighten up screws to avoid hardware from coming loose.Inspect Weatherstripping: Replace damaged weatherstripping to guarantee energy effectiveness.Frequently asked question SectionQ1: How often should I lubricate my door hardware?
A1: It's finest to lube hinges and locks every six months or as required, specifically in locations with high humidity.
Q2: Can I repair door hardware myself?
A2: Yes, lots of minor repairs can be done with fundamental tools and some DIY understanding. For complex problems, consider employing a professional.
Q3: What should I do if my lock is stuck?
A3: First, attempt applying lube. If it still doesn't work, the lock may require to be dismantled or replaced.
Q4: How can I prevent my door from squeaking?
A4: Regularly oil the hinges and inspect for correct alignment to prevent squeaking.
Q5: When is it time to replace my door hardware?
A5: If the hardware is damaged beyond repair or if it frequently malfunctions in spite of regular maintenance, replacement may be required.
